Ako vytvorit novu API kontrolu
Vytvorenie novej API kontroly s LoadFocus
Je celkom jednoduche vytvorit novu API kontrolu pre endpoint pomocou UI zo stranky New API Check.
Kroky na konfiguraciu novej API kontroly
1. Priatelsky nazov API kontroly
Automaticky generujeme priatelsky nazov kontroly pre vasu API kontrolu pomocou aktualneho datumu a casu. Mozete ho manualne upravit a nastavit novy nazov. Tento nazov pouzijeme v upozorneniach.
Pozrite si viac podrobnosti o Priatelskom nazve kontroly.
2. Konfiguracia poziadavky API kontroly
Nastavte URL endpoint vasho testovaneho API a vyberte z povolenych HTTP metod: GET, POST, PUT, PATCH, DELETE. Mozete tiez konfigurovat parametre dotazu, hlavicky, telo POST, zakladnu autentifikaciu, preskocenie SSL a sledovanie presmerovani.
Pozrite si viac podrobnosti o Konfiguracii poziadavky.
3. Nahled poziadavky API kontroly
Simulujte poziadavku z ktorejkolvek z 26 cloudovych lokalit na nahladenie, ako sa API kontrola bude spravat. Skontrolujte cas odozvy a metriky ako Wait, DNS, TCP, TLS, Request, First Byte a Download. Zobrazte plne telo odpovede API, ako aj hlavicky poziadavky a odpovede.
Pozrite si viac podrobnosti o Nahlade poziadavky.
4. Frekvencia API kontroly
Vyberte, ako casto chcete spustat API kontrolu, s moznostami od kazdych 10 sekund po kazdych 48 hodin. Tato flexibilita pomaha pri nepretrzitom monitorovani zdravia a vykonnosti vasho API.
Pozrite si viac podrobnosti o Frekvencii.
5. Limity API kontroly - Nastavenie limitov casu odozvy
Oznacte kontrolu ako degradovanu alebo neuspesnu na zaklade limitov casu odozvy. Nakonfigurujte prahy degradacie a neuspesnosti v milisekundach na vcastnu identifikaciu problemov s vykonnostou.
Pozrite si viac podrobnosti o Limitoch casu odozvy.
6. Tvrdenia API kontroly
Overte stavovy kod, telo, hlavicky a cas odozvy vasej API poziadavky. Ked jedno alebo viac tvrdeni zlyhaju, spusti sa upozornenie.
Pozrite si viac podrobnosti o Tvrdeniach.
7. Lokality API kontroly
Spustite API kontrolu z jednej alebo viacerych lokalit. Ak kontrola zlyhá v jednej lokalite, cela kontrola je oznacena ako neuspesna. Vyberte dve alebo viac lokalit pre lepsie poznatky o latencii vasej aplikacie.
Pozrite si viac podrobnosti o Lokalitach.
8. Kanaly upozorneni API kontroly
Vyberte kanaly upozorneni, na ktorych chcete byt informovani, ked tato kontrola zlyhá a obnovi sa. Mozete nastavit upozornenia na viacero emailovych adries, kanalov Slack a/alebo kanalov Microsoft Teams.
Pozrite si viac podrobnosti o Kanaloch upozorneni.
9. Aktivacia/Deaktivacia API kontroly
Prepnite API kontrolu na AKTIVOVANU alebo DEAKTIVOVANU. Ked je deaktivovana, API kontrola sa nebude spustat podla nakonfigurovaneho planu a bude zobrazena ako seda v zozname API kontrol.
Pozrite si viac podrobnosti o Aktivacii/Deaktivacii.
10. Stlmenie/Zrusenie stlmenia API kontroly
Prepnite API kontrolu na STLMENU alebo NESTLMENU. Ked je stlmena, API kontrola sa bude naďalej spustat podla planu alebo na poziadanie, ale nebudu sa odosielat ziadne upozornenia.
Pozrite si viac podrobnosti o Stlmeni/Zruseni stlmenia.
11. Ulozenie a spustenie API kontroly
Kliknite na tlacidlo "Run Now" na nahladenie poziadavky a zistenie, ci aktualna API kontrola prechádza alebo zlyhava. Z tejto obrazovky nahľadu mozete tiez ulozit API kontrolu na spustanie podla nakonfigurovaneho planu.
Pozrite si viac podrobnosti o Ulozeni a spusteni.
Podla tychto krokov mozete jednoducho nastavit a monitorovat vase API endpointy, aby ste zabezpecili ich optimalnu vykonnost a dostupnost pre vasich pouzivatelov.
Vsetky vase API kontroly najdete na stranke API Monitors.